Output e00577f4c13ae1ef8460debf3ab84224d255108421cb17b5a323f0e5ad41daf6:1

value
429102600
script pubkey
OP_0 OP_PUSHBYTES_20 27655a689bc5b4e2a945286ead665de6da826a27
address
ltc1qyaj456ymck6w92299ph26ejaumdgy6380k4m0k
transaction
e00577f4c13ae1ef8460debf3ab84224d255108421cb17b5a323f0e5ad41daf6
spent
true